Ingredients You’ll Need
These Chocolate Peanut Butter Cookies use simple and wholesome ingredients that come together beautifully. You might already have most of them in your pantry!
For the Cookies
- 1/2 cup shortening (regular or butter flavor)
- 3/4 cup creamy peanut butter
- 1 1/2 cups packed brown sugar
- 3 tablespoons milk
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 large egg
- 1 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/2 teaspoon salt

How to Make Chocolate Peanut Butter Cookies
Step 1: Preheat Your Oven
Preheating your oven to 375°F (190°C) is crucial as it ensures even baking. A hot oven helps set the edges of the cookies while keeping the centers soft and chewy.
Step 2: Mix Wet 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, use an electric mixer to blend together the shortening, creamy peanut butter, brown sugar, milk, and vanilla extract until everything is well combined. This step creates a smooth base that contributes to the cookie’s tender texture.
Step 3: Add the Egg
Now it’s time to add that large egg! Mix it into your wet mixture until just incorporated. The egg acts as a binder, helping all the ingredients stick together perfectly.
Step 4: Combine Dry Ingredients
In a separate b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, unsweetened cocoa powder, baking soda, and salt. This step ensures that your dry ingredients are evenly distributed throughout the dough.
Step 5: Mix It All Together
Gradually add your dry mixture into the wet mixture, stirring until fully combined. Be careful not to overmix—this keeps your cookies light and fluffy!
Step 6: Scoop Dough onto Cookie Sheet
Scoop out about 1 to 1 1/2 inch dough balls onto an ungreased cookie sheet. This is where you can involve the kids! Let them help shape those cute little dough balls.
Step 7: Create Crisscross Patterns
Using a fork, gently press down each dough ball to create that classic crisscross pattern on top. Not only does this look fantastic, but it also helps them bake evenly.
Step 8: Bake Your Cookies
Pop those cookie sheets into your preheated oven and bake for 7-8 minutes until the edges are just set. Keep an eye on them; overbaking can lead to crunchy cookies instead of chewy ones!
Step 9: Cool Down
Let your delightful Chocolate Peanut Butter Cookies cool on the cookie sheet for about two minutes before transferring them to a wire cooling rack. This allows them to firm up slightly without losing their soft texture.

Pro Tips for Making Chocolate Peanut Butter Cookies
Baking cookies can be a delightful experience, and with a few handy tips, you can ensure that your Chocolate Peanut Butter Cookies turn out perfectly every time!
-
Use room temperature ingredients: Bringing your shortening, peanut butter, and egg to room temperature helps them blend better, resulting in a smoother dough and softer cookies.
-
Do not overmix the dough: Once you combine the wet and dry ingredients, mix just until everything is incorporated. Overmixing can lead to tough cookies instead of the soft, chewy texture we desire.
-
Chill the cookie dough: If you have the time, chilling your dough for about 30 minutes before baking can enhance the flavors and help the cookies hold their shape better during baking.
-
Check for doneness early: Ovens can vary in temperature. Start checking your cookies at the 7-minute mark to prevent overbaking; they should look slightly soft in the center when you take them out.
-
Store properly: To keep your cookies fresh longer, store them in an airtight container at room temperature. You can also freeze them for later enjoyment; just make sure to layer them with parchment paper to avoid sticking!

Make Ahead and Storage
These Chocolate Peanut Butter Cookies are not just delicious; they’re perfect for meal prep! You can easily whip up a batch ahead of time and have sweet treats ready for when cravings strike.
Storing Leftovers
- Store the c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to one week.
- For optimal freshness, place parchment paper between layers of cookies to prevent sticking.
Freezing
- Allow the cookies to cool completely before freezing.
- Place them in a single layer on a baking sheet and freeze until solid.
- Transfer the frozen cookies to a freezer-safe bag or container, sealing tightly. They can be stored for up to three months.
Reheating
- To enjoy your cookies warm,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Place the cookies on a baking sheet and warm them for about 5 minutes.
- You can also microwave them for about 10-15 seconds, but keep an eye on them to avoid overheating!
FAQs
Have questions? We’ve got you covered!
Can I make Chocolate Peanut Butter Cookies without shortening?
Yes! You can substitute shortening with coconut oil or your favorite dairy-free butter alternative. Just make sure it’s softened for easier mixing!
What makes these Chocolate Peanut Butter Cookies chewy?
The combination of brown sugar and peanut butter gives these cookies their wonderfully chewy texture. Be careful not to overbake them; they should be soft when you take them out of the oven.
How long do Chocolate Peanut Butter Cookies last?
If stored properly in an airtight container, these cookies can last up to one week at room temperature. For longer storage, consider freezing them!
Can I add chocolate chips to my Chocolate Peanut Butter Cookies?
Absolutely! Fold in some dairy-free chocolate chips into the dough before baking for an extra chocolatey treat.
Are Chocolate Peanut Butter Cookies suitable for vegan diets?
You can easily make this recipe vegan by using a flax egg (1 tablespoon ground flaxseed mixed with 2.5 tablespoons water) instead of an egg and ensuring all other ingredients are plant-based.

Ingredients
- 1/2 cup shortening (regular or butter flavor)
- 3/4 cup creamy peanut butter
- 1 1/2 cups packed brown sugar
- 3 tablespoons milk
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 large egg
- 1 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
- In a mixing bowl, blend shortening, peanut butter, brown sugar, milk, and vanilla until smooth.
- Add the egg and mix until combined.
- In another bowl, whisk together fl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, and salt.
- Gradually add dry ingredients to wet mixture and stir until just combined.
- Scoop dough into balls (about 1 to 1.5 inches) onto an ungreased cookie sheet.
- Use a fork to create crisscross patterns on each dough ball.
- Bake for 7-8 minutes until edges are set but centers remain soft.
- Let cool on the sheet for about two minutes before transferring to a wire rack.
